Design-Build
The distinctive feature of a design-build project is that the client contracts with a single entity to provide the entire project, from preliminary planning through design and then construction.

When compared with the traditional or construction management methods of organizing a construction project, design-build offers certain advantages.
As with a construction management project, but unlike a traditional project, it is possible to fast-track a design-build job. That is, Superior Design-Build can award construction contracts for early phases of the work before the final working drawings have been completed for subsequent phases. Yet, unlike a construction management project, design-build offers a client a sole source of responsibility and authority on the project.
Design-Build also offers owners the opportunity to contract with a single source of specialized design and construction services. For this reason, design-build is common on complex, engineered construction projects such as industrial facilities and utility plants. Design-build also affords the client more financial security or more competitive project insurance rates or coverages than would otherwise be available.
Our design / build services fall into four categories described below:
Preliminary
- Define project specific issues
- Develop master plan
Design Development
- Develop schematic designs
- Prepare cost and schedule proposals
- Receive owner approval
Pre-Construction
- Execute design engineering
- Develop final construction documents
- Purchase non owner supplied equipment
- Prepare construction contract documents
- Solicit for bids / recommend awards
Construction
- Provide temporary utilities and facilities for project
- Conduct pre-construction meetings with contractors
- Review safety procedures of individual contractors
- Update construction schedule
- Review contractor quality of work
- Manage contractor pay requests process
- Conduct weekly job site meetings
- Manage change order process
- Provide construction observation and daily job site field reports
- Manage commissioning and startup
